Abstract
The antioxidant activities of aqueous extracts from four kinds of fish eggs
were examined by determining the oxidative stability of polyunsaturated fa
tty acids (PUFAs) in salmon egg and soybean phosphatidylcholine (PC) liposo
mes. The extracts from salmon eggs, trout eggs, shark eggs, and herring egg
s showed antioxidant activities on the oxidation of both PC liposomes. When
trout egg extracts were further separated into low molecular components (M
W < 5000) and high molecular components (MW > 5000), the activity of the fo
rmer fraction was higher than that of the latter fraction, which was mainly
composed of proteins. These results demonstrate that the aqueous antioxida
nts may be important for protecting fish eggs against oxidative stress.
